Essential Information Matheran

Things To Know Before Travelling To Matheran

Before you plan your trip to Matheran, here are a few essential things you should know.

Some of the essential information regarding Matheran tourism are weather, accommodation, and major attractions. Also, learn about their local culture and traditions before you start your journey.

Weather:

Travelling during the monsoon Season (July to September) should be avoided as the weather is not good. Usually in monsoon, there are higher chances of landslides occurring. Summer and Winter are both enjoyable times to visit Matheran. The temperature in summer ranges between 22 to 33 degrees Celsius and in Winter the temperature ranges around 8 degrees Celsius.

Accommodation:

Book accommodation in advance to avoid disappointment. As you can face availability issues during the peak season. There is something for every budget: cottages, resorts, hotels, and camps. There are places to stay like Westend Hotel Matheran, Adamo the Village, and Scarlet Resort.

What To Bring:

The most important thing is to bring cash and cards. You should also carry travel documents to avoid any mishaps. Don't forget to bring essential items like a power bank, medication, insect repellent, torches, and water bottles, and don't forget to bring warm clothes, especially during the winter season.

Safety:

Matheran is generally a safe place but it's advisable to take precautions. It is important to stay hydrated while doing trekking and hiking. Always be aware of your surroundings. Keep emergency helpline number of police and ambulance.

Best Places to Visit In Matheran:

You can visit famous places in Matheran like Louisa Point, Charlotte Lake, Alexander, Point, One Tree Hill Point, and Irshalgad Fort.

Tips for travellers visiting Matheran

Book your accommodations and travel plans in advance to avoid any mishaps, especially during peak seasons. Pack comfortable walking shoes or hiking boots as Matheran offers scenic trails. Bring cash as not everywhere cards are accepted. Pack warm and comfortable clothes. Keep a rain jacket and umbrella for unexpected showers. Bring sunscreen and insect repellent to protect yourself from sun and bugs. Before you leave, make sure to check the weather and road conditions, especially during monsoon and winter season. Don't forget to pack a torch and power bank.
